I 13ff
Category Confusion/Ryle: category confusion means counting elements in the same category as the set.
I 35 f
Reasonable Actions: reasonable actions are not the origin but design-distinguished.
Conscious act: a conscious act is not two actions.
>Reason, >Consciousness.
Physical/Mental: are two descriptions of the same.
>Description levels, >Levels(Order).
I 37/38
The habit of talking loudly is not loud itself.
I 46
Feeling "in the head": I do not feel the rolling of the ship in the head, but in the legs.
I 49
Ability: an ability is not reciting rules, but applying them. Ability is not an event word but a modal word. The disposition of ability is no second action beside the first.
>Disposition, >Ability.
I 162f
Law - Error/Ryle: It is an error to confuse hypothetical generalizations with categorical individual judgments, e.g. a ticket entitles to a ride, it is not the ride itself. Laws give authority for inference, not the inference itself (facts: are stations).
